T23.791A
ICD-10-CMCorrosion of third degree of multiple sites of right wrist and hand, initial encounter
This code signifies a severe, full-thickness burn (corrosion) affecting multiple areas of the right wrist and hand. The injury involves destruction of all skin layers, potentially extending into subcutaneous tissue, muscle, or bone, and typically presents with a leathery appearance and insensitivity to touch.
Apply this code for patients presenting with a third-degree chemical burn to multiple sites on their right wrist and hand during the initial phase of treatment. This includes the emergency department visit, initial hospitalization, or first outpatient encounter for this specific injury.
